What color is Godzilla?

Godzilla was originally grey skinned. Often people mistakenly believe him to be green because the original film was in black and white, but the artwork on promotional materials in the U.S.A. and other English speaking countries were coloured in green instead of the proper grey of the Godzilla creature suit. The image of a green Godzilla has persisted, in cartoons, toys, and elsewhere, despite him being grey in the majority of his films. The only two Godzilla films where godzilla actually has a green hue to his skin is: Godzilla 2000 and Godzilla vs. Megaguirus. This is reflected in the related video games.
